2. What is a cookie?

A cookie is a small text file that our website saves on your device when you visit us. It allows the site to remember your browser on subsequent visits and facilitates navigation, security, and certain personalized features.

Cookies do not contain sensitive personal data such as your full name, ID number or financial data, but they can be linked to information associated with your account or your browsing behavior.

3. Types and categories of cookies

  • Technical or essential (strictly necessary) : These are essential for the basic operation of the site, for example, to keep you logged in, manage your shopping cart, or ensure security. They do not require explicit consent.
  • Functional or preference : they remember your choices and settings, such as language, region, or certain custom options.
  • Analytics or performance : collect aggregated and anonymous data on how users interact with the site, which sections are visited most, what errors occur, or how navigation between pages occurs.
  • Advertising, marketing or behavioral : allow you to show personalized ads on this site or on others, based on your interests and your browsing activity.
  • Third-party cookies : These are installed by domains other than this site (for example, social networks, advertising providers, external analytics tools, or payment services).
